VPS如何固定IP?_Linux与Windows系统详细配置指南
VPS如何设置固定IP地址?不同操作系统下的操作步骤有哪些?
| 操作系统 | 主要步骤 | 关键配置参数 | 验证方法 |
|---|---|---|---|
| Linux | 1. 编辑网络配置文件2. 修改BOOTPROTO为static3. 设置IPADDR、NETMASK、GATEWAY | IPADDR=192.168.x.xNETMASK=255.255.255.0GATEWAY=192.168.x.1 | ip addrping测试 |
| Windows | 1. 进入网络适配器设置2. 选择IPv4属性3. 手动输入IP信息 | IP地址、子网掩码、默认网关 | ipconfig远程连接测试 |
# VPS固定IP地址配置全指南
## 一、固定IP的重要性
固定IP地址对于需要稳定网络连接的VPS应用至关重要,特别是用于:
- 网站服务器托管
- 邮件服务器搭建
- 远程桌面服务
- 数据库服务器部署
## 二、Linux系统固定IP步骤
### 1. 准备工作
```bash
# 查看当前网络接口信息
ip addr
# 确定要配置的网卡名称(通常为ens33或eth0)
```
### 2. 编辑网络配置文件
```bash
vi /etc/sysconfig/network-scripts/ifcfg-ens33
```
修改或添加以下参数:
```
BOOTPROTO=static
ONBOOT=yes
IPADDR=192.168.88.130
NETMASK=255.255.255.0
GATEWAY=192.168.88.2
DNS1=8.8.8.8
```
### 3. 重启网络服务
```bash
systemctl restart network
# 或使用旧版命令
service network restart
```
### 4. 验证配置
```bash
ip addr show ens33
ping www.baidu.com
```
## 三、Windows系统固定IP步骤
1. **打开网络连接设置**
- 控制面板 > 网络和共享中心 > 更改适配器设置
- 右键选择"属性" > Internet协议版本4(TCP/IPv4)
2. **配置静态IP**
- 选择"使用下面的IP地址"
- 输入IP地址、子网掩码、默认网关
- 设置首选DNS服务器
3. **保存并测试**
- 使用ipconfig命令验证
- 尝试远程连接测试
## 四、常见问题解决方案
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| 网络连接失败 | IP地址冲突 | 更换IP地址段 |
| 无法访问外网 | 网关配置错误 | 检查GATEWAY设置 |
| DNS解析失败 | DNS服务器不可用 | 更换为8.8.8.8等公共DNS |
| 配置不生效 | 网卡名称错误 | 确认ifcfg-ens33中的DEVICE参数 |
## 五、高级配置建议
1. **多IP地址配置**
- 创建ifcfg-ens33:0等副接口文件
- 每个文件配置一个独立IP地址
2. **防火墙设置**
```bash
VPS实体服务器如何选择?_ - 存储类型(SSD优于HDD)和空间大小
# 开放特定端口
firewall-cmd --zone=public --add-port=80/tcp --permanent
firewall-cmd --reload
```
3. **网络监控**
- 使用nethogs监控流量
- 设置cron定期检查网络连通性
通过以上步骤,您可以成功为VPS配置固定IP地址,确保网络连接的稳定性和可靠性。根据实际需求选择适合的操作系统配置方法,并注意定期检查网络配置的有效性。
发表评论